Job Summary

  • The Associate Logistics Analyst will serve as the end-to-end Process Owner for Logistics and Shipping at the PR01 site, ensuring operational standards and compliance support business needs and regulatory requirements.
  • This role involves coordinating shipments, managing warehouse capacity, and continuously improving logistics, shipping, and material storage processes to support site growth and operational continuity.
